Steal Their Class!

Xbox Live is free for Silver users of the Xbox 360 for the next 5 days in Europe. I just tried Modern Warfare 2 and had my ass handed to me. Didn’t take long for me to see the infamous deathstreak “Steal Their Class!” notice. I was the lowest level player there. Highest was about 67, next lowest was 26. Sigh. Not tempted to buy a Gold membership any more. Thanks Microsoft 🙂

steal-their-class

I didn’t disconnect on purpose. WIFI died right after I died for the 5th or 6th time. (If you were on you just saw me disconnect, honest!) I swear those guys were probably looking out for the dumb newbie. I’m sure my curiosity will be piqued again in the next few days.

The coop in MW2 is excellent though. I might be willing to part with some cash if some friends were online regularly to play that!

  2. Having played MW2 Spec Ops last night with Mark I’m revising my thoughts about Xbox Live. I know I won’t get a chance to play it more than once a week but damn, it was fun.

    Was a pain to get going as the Xbox reported my network was using a strict NAT. Once I enabled upnp on my wifi router and dsl router it all worked ok!
